Unplug the router's power cable for 30 seconds, plug it back in, and clear your browser cache. Try logging in using the default credentials ( admin / admin ). My Wi-Fi password no longer works Cause: The firmware flash fully wiped the custom settings.
Look at the physical sticker on the bottom of your router. It must explicitly say TL-WR850N(UN) Ver: 3.0 (or V3). Installing firmware meant for V1 or V2 will brick your device.
